学编程一阵子后,我发现用PHP处理多条表单信息真有意思,实用性还很强!今天就和大伙儿聊聊这个话题,有兴趣的小伙伴快来试试。
创建HTML表单
首先,你得先做个能装下好几个记录的HTML表格。接着,为每个纪录设置一个唯一的名称标签。比如说,如果你要收集用户信息,那么可以用三个不同的标签来记名字、年龄和邮箱。这样做有啥好处?等数据传到服务器后,我们就能根据这些标签轻松定位到每条纪录!
搞定这玩意得了解点HTML知识,但不用怕,其实很简单!记住给每个字段取个特别的名称,例如起名叫”name”,PHP就能顺利识别出你输入的内容了。
访问表单数据
在PHP编程中,想获取表单填写内容很简单!使用那个叫做’$_POST’的超级全局变量即可搞定。就像个大口袋,通过POST方式传递来的数据都会被装进来。只要点击提交,你填写的所有内容都会自动塞进这袋子里。你就可以随便看看、处理这些数据。
比如你有个叫做’username’的输入框,想知道用户输的什么?那直接用这个`$_POST[‘username’]`就行,简单又方便!
迭代循环记录
想要搞掂数据,每个记录咱可不能放过。这时候,我们就要祭出循环这个好东西了!不论是`foreach`还是`for`的套路,它们都能帮你细细品味`$_POST`数组中的每一段故事
例如,如果我们有多个用户记录,我们可以这样写循环:
php每次你输入的信息,我会用$key和$value这两个词来代表它的名字跟数值!
//处理每条记录的逻辑
}这样,我们就能确保每条记录都被处理到,不会遗漏。
存储数据
foreach ($firstNames as $index => $firstName) { $lastName = $lastNames[$index]; // 处理记录 }搞定那些数据以后,我们要把它们存到数据库或别的地方去。这时候就需要用到一些数据库操作。举个例子,你可以用SQL语句来插入数据之类的。
在PHP编程中,我们需要用MySQLi或PDO这样的数据库扩展程序连接并操作数据库,而且重要的是要确保将网页表单传来的数据正确地存储进数据库!
总结与反思
PHP处理表单超好用!以后工作全靠它~这次学的实在是太多了,等我消化几天再分享给同样热爱编程的你们一起进步。
说正事儿我们来聊聊大家遇到过哪些烦心的PHP处理表单数据的问题呗!我就在评论区等你们的故事了咱们互相取经、帮助别人。别忘了给我点个赞、分享出去让更多小伙伴儿学到这个小技巧。
foreach ($firstNames as $index => $firstName) { $lastName = $lastNames[$index]; // 连接到数据库并将数据存储在表中 }原文链接:https://www.icz.com/technicalinformation/web/2024/05/16018.html,转载请注明出处~~~
评论0